SINGAPORE, Aug 24 — The Elections Department has apologised after almost 10,000 voters in Tanjong Pagar received two poll cards — most of them with different serial numbers — due to an error by a printing company.

ELD said it had “received feedback from some voters of Tanjong Pagar Group Representation Constituency that they received two poll cards with different voter’s serial numbers”. Of the 9,822 voters, 9,354 received two poll cards with differing voter’s serial numbers. The remaining 486 voters received two poll cards with identical information, the agency added.
